Understanding Spots on Ankles and Feet: Causes, Diagnosis, and Treatment Options

When it comes to skin health, the appearance of spots on ankles and feet can raise concerns for many individuals. These discolorations can vary widely in appearance, from small red or brown marks to larger lesion-like patches. While some spots are harmless and transient, others might indicate underlying health conditions requiring medical attention.
